Question for you X1 lovers?
Can you explain to me what is so great abt this vehicle? Why this over an F20, F31, or F25?
Your opinion would be appreciated b/c obviously BMW thinks this vehicle is a good fit for the US market over the F20/F21. When the US gets the F31, it will prob have very few engine/tranny choices. I, personally, don't get it. I must be missing something obvious because Audi is doing the same thing by axing the A4 avant and bringing over the Allroad. To me the Allroad and the X1 seem very similar in terms of height, utility, and image. I don't particularly care for the allroad, nor the X1.

It will sell well due to price, handling, fuel economy and for those that don't have a big family or no kids at all. It really doesn't compete with the Allroad but the upcoming Audi Q3 and new small Mercedes and others to be launched. It's the bet selling SUV in Europe (premium brand). Why do people buy an X3 verses an X5 and it basically appllies to the X1. Most people prefer the look of an SUV over a wagon even if the wagon makes more sense in handling and economy.

I am looking to get one because it offers more space than a 3 series and for much cheaper.
In fact it will be the cheapest AWD vehicle BMW offers in the US but at the same time offer the same engines that the 3,X3, and 5 series offer. The question should be: who would pay $5K+ extra for a 3 series wagon over this or even a 3 series sedan with AWD over the X1, except for its newer design styling. Only thing that pisses me off is how you have to buy a premium and lighting package on the 28i just to get xenon lights. That's $5200 in packages of stuff I dont need, just give me $900 xenons. |

Referencing the Allroad, I just got my new Autoweek and it says the base price is $40,475 and the only engine is the 2.0 gas. It is a lot heavier (3891) than the X1 and longer. The dropped the A4 Avanti and added this so it competes with the new 3 wagon with all wheel drive in the spring. Autoweek said it was a pretty noisy vehicle because it sits so high.

Built a 328xi M Sport and a X1 xdrive 28i M Sport both M sport versions give you the same things added Leather, heated seats, premium sound, metallic paint the 328xi doesn't have any standard items that the X1 doesn't... X1 = $39,620 328xi = $46,620 $7,000 difference, 17.7% upcharge for what? same engine, almost the same size. Also a X3 is $3,000 cheaper than a 3 series sedan built the same! I guess BMW is the only car manufacturer that things their sedans are worth more than their SUVs. |

Here in the UK the X1 is great but once you add a few extras you quickly start getting into X3 costing. We had an X1 and the extras added 20% to the price. A simular spec'd X3 was only 10% for the extras and only 10% dearer. So it quickly (for us) became a no brainer to go for the X3. But the X1 is a great car jsut the way BMW price it here in the UK!
